The BPJEPS "socio-educational and cultural activities" qualification enables the holder to carry out his/her professional activity independently, using one or more technical aids in the fields of educational, cultural and social activities, within the limits of the regulatory frameworks.

The activity leader is responsible for his or her action from an educational, technical and organisational point of view and ensures the safety of third parties and the public in his or her charge.

The holder of this BP JEPS is able to:

  • responsibly lead an educational action that is part of the structure's project
  • supervise all types of public, in all reception or practice venues, taking into account the public and the territorial contexts in which these public live.
  • propose and design projects based on the observations made of the public they are hosting and the funding available to the structure

The BPJEPS activity leader meets the requirements relating to the functions of activity leader in holiday and leisure camps, of the code of social action and families.


BC01 - Design and implement activity projects as part of the work organisation of a structure in the field of sport or activity

Locate yourself in your area and identify the local players

Identify the needs of the various target audiences with particular attention to audiences in a disability situation(s)

Propose and organise a project taking into account the resources that can be mobilised within the structure, and the potential ecological impact of the project

Monitor the actions carried out by organising those of each member of the team

Complete the administrative obligations using different digital tools

Report the conclusions of the project to its manager, identifying the main positive factors and points for improvement

BC02 - Promoting the activities and projects of a structure in the field of sport or entertainment

Communicating information about the activities on offer

Adapting your communication to the characteristics and needs of the public, in particular people with disabilities,

Selecting tools and writing communication content

BC03 - Design, run, safely and evaluate activity sequences and cultural, educational or social activity sessions

Define the objectives of an activity sequence, by integrating an educational progression

Choosing appropriate animation methods and tools

Defining the content, conduct and evaluation of the animation sequence

Welcoming the public during the activity session, presenting the collective framework of the session, its conduct, its rules, with a view to encouraging them to join in

Gathering the requests and expectations expressed by the participants

Leading the planned session independently and safely

Supporting the participants, using popular education approaches, to encourage their emancipation

Adapting the planned session, identifying any obstacles or difficulties encountered

Evaluating the effects of the activity session, by gathering feedback from the public

Analysing the activity sequence in order to formulate proposals for improvement

BC04 - Organising and supervising the "living together" of the public welcomed

Building relationships with the personal and professional entourage of the public welcomed

Disseminating verified information on societal issues

Regulating group phenomena

Organising transitional times, calm times or periods of free time by adapting them to the characteristics of the audiences

Instablish interactions within the group

Develop approaches that enable the group to function harmoniously by strengthening the psychosocial skills of each individual

Maximum total duration of 1,300 hours, including 600 hours on the job and 700 hours at the training centre.
The duration of the course is indicative and will be determined according to your profile.
